The retinoic acid receptor beta (Rarb) region of Mmu14 is associated with prion disease incubation time in mouse.
In neurodegenerative conditions such as Alzheimer's and prion disease it has been shown that host genetic background can have a significant effect on susceptibility. Indeed, human genome-wide association studies (GWAS) have implicated several candidate genes. Understanding such genetic suscepti...
